This is the seven sisters story. I was given this story by my father, David Curley. It’s about seven sisters who are running away from nyiru (a man who is after the oldest sister). They travelled all the way from Port Pirie and then travelled around Australia before ending in the Desert. The sisters kept changing to trick the man, but he kept changing too. This is a very important Tjurkurpa — true story.
